Volvo Invests $260 Million to Expand Global Crawler Excavator Production

Volvo Construction Equipment (Volvo CE) is embarking on a significant global expansion of its crawler excavator production, announcing a substantial investment of $260 million. This strategic capital injection is poised to bolster manufacturing capacity and enhance technological capabilities across its key excavator facilities worldwide. The primary objective is to meet the burgeoning global demand for these essential construction machines, particularly in the face of accelerating infrastructure development, urbanization, and a growing emphasis on sustainable construction practices. This investment signals a strong commitment from Volvo CE to solidify its market leadership and cater to the evolving needs of its diverse customer base across various continents. The expansion is not merely about increasing unit output; it encompasses a holistic approach to optimizing production processes, integrating advanced manufacturing technologies, and ensuring the highest standards of quality and efficiency in every crawler excavator that rolls off the assembly line.

The $260 million investment will be strategically allocated across Volvo CE’s existing excavator manufacturing sites. While specific breakdowns for each location are not fully disclosed, it is understood that significant upgrades and expansions will occur at facilities in Europe, Asia, and North America. These expansions are designed to streamline production flows, incorporate state-of-the-art automation, and increase the overall footprint of these critical manufacturing hubs. The rationale behind this global approach is to ensure localized production capabilities that can efficiently serve regional markets, thereby reducing lead times, optimizing logistics, and offering greater responsiveness to customer demands. By decentralizing and strengthening production, Volvo CE aims to mitigate supply chain vulnerabilities and ensure a consistent and reliable supply of crawler excavators to its global clientele, regardless of geographical location or prevailing market conditions. This multi-pronged expansion strategy underscores Volvo CE’s long-term vision for global growth and its dedication to being a reliable partner in the construction industry’s most demanding projects.

The crawler excavator market is experiencing robust growth driven by several key factors. Firstly, global population growth and urbanization continue to fuel significant investments in infrastructure development, including roads, bridges, public transportation systems, and utilities. These projects invariably require heavy-duty machinery like crawler excavators for tasks such as digging, trenching, demolition, and material handling. Secondly, a growing emphasis on infrastructure renewal and modernization in developed economies, coupled with new development projects in emerging markets, creates a persistent and expanding demand for these versatile machines. Thirdly, the construction equipment rental market is also on the rise, further contributing to the overall demand for excavators. Volvo CE’s strategic investment is a direct response to these market dynamics, ensuring they are well-positioned to capitalize on this sustained growth trajectory.
